Analysis
The most recent figure for tree-covered areas — area from modis in Côte d'Ivoire is 27,064 1000 ha, measured in 2024.
That represents a change of up 0.1% on the previous year and down 1.6% over ten years.
Over the whole period, tree-covered areas — area from modis in Côte d'Ivoire peaked at 27,759 1000 ha in 2010 and was at its lowest, 25,541 1000 ha, in 2001.
Côte d'Ivoire ranks 34th of 240 countries on this measure, in the top quarter.

About this data
The FAOSTAT domain on Land Cover data under the Agri-Environmental Indicators section contains land cover information organized by the land cover classes of the international standard system for Environmental and Economic Accounting Central Framework (SEEA CF). The land cover information is compiled from publicly available Global Land Cover (GLC) maps: a) MODIS land cover types based on the Land Cover Classification System, LCCS; b) The European Spatial Agency (ESA) Climate Change Initiative (CCI) annual land cover maps produced by the Université catholique de Louvain (UCL)-Geomatics and now under the European Copernicus Program; c) The annual land cover maps which were produced under the European Copernicus Global Land Service (CGLS) (CGLS land cover, containing discrete land cover categorization), with spatial resolution 100m; and d) the WorldCover maps of the European Space Agency, produced at 10m resolution.
